| At my house, we have a holiday tradition: Every Christmas Eve, my wife and I unwrap our presents and stick the bows on the dogs. They try to get them off, of course, but at least one of the three will end up with at least one bow still stuck to her head or bottom at the end of the evening. It's silly, but we do it every year. Each dog also has a stocking, which we fill with biscuits, rawhide chews and other treats. (No nosing into the stockings until Christmas Eve!) What do you do for your pet?
